Bark For Your Park
Finalists have been announced for “Bark for Your Park,” a national contest to award one U.S. community $100,000 toward building a local dog park.

PetSafe, a manufacturer of pet behavior and lifestyle products, has announced the 15 finalist cities for “Bark for Your Park,” a national contest to award one U.S. community $100,000 toward building a local dog park.
The 15 finalist cities are:
- Allentown, Penn.
- Bullhead City, Ariz.
- Derby, Vt.
- Fort Dodge, Iowa
- Huntington, W.V.
- Kirkland, Wash.
- Lynchburg, Va.
- Mission Viejo, Calif.
- Mobile, Ala.
- Montgomery, Ala.
- Orland Park, Ill.
- Pacifica, Calif.
- Plainfield, Ind.
- Warsaw, Indiana
- Westfield, Ind.

At the end of the three-week voting stage, the finalist community with the most votes will receive $100,000 toward building a PetSafe dog park.
So why put the vote to the community, rather than a judging panel?
“As a leader in pet behavior and lifestyle products, we are a company of pet lovers,” says Randy Boyd, president and CEO of PetSafe. “We truly understand the passion of pet lovers in this country, and we wanted to put the power in their hands. The city with the most enthusiasm will win.”
